Operation of the A/D converter can be disabled or enabled using the module stop control register.
The initial setting is for operation of the A/D converter to be halted. Register access is enabled by
clearing module stop mode. For details, refer to section 22, Power-Down Modes.

This LSI’s analog input is designed so that conversion precision is guaranteed for an input signal
for which the signal source impedance is 10 k or less. This specification is provided to enable
the A/D converter’s sample-and-hold circuit input capacitance to be charged within the sampling
time; if the sensor output impedance exceeds 10 k , charging may be insufficient and it may not
be possible to guarantee the A/D conversion accuracy. However, if a large capacitance is provided
externally for conversion in single mode, the input load will essentially comprise only the internal
input resistance of 10 k , and the signal source impedance is ignored. However, since a low-pass
filter effect is obtained in this case, it may not be possible to follow an analog signal with a large
differential coefficient (e.g., 5 mV/ s or greater) (see figure 16.6). When converting a high-speed
analog signal or conversion in scan mode, a low-impedance buffer should be inserted.
